Example of databases Search Engines:- May be you don't realise it but you probably use a database almost everyday of your life. You will no doubt be familiar with using a search engine like google. Library database:- A library stores detail of all their books in a database. When you want to know if a book is in stock in OPAC you can enter either title, auther, or ISBN number and search information about the book. You can find out how many copies are stored not only by your SDTML Library but also other tiss branch libraries. The database also records details of all the borrowers. When they return their books the librarian will be informed if they are overdue and whether there are any fines outstanding.

A database management system (DBMS) is system software for creating and managing databases The DBMS provides users and programmers with a systematic way to create, retrieve, update and manage data. A DBMS makes it possible for end users to create, read, update and delete data in a database. The DBMS essentially serves as an interface between the database and end users or application programs ensuring that data is consistently organized and remains easily accessible.
10
Work done by DBMS The DBMS manages three important things: the data, the database engine that allows data to be accessed, locked and modified and the database schema which defines the database’s logical structure. These three foundational elements help provide concurrency, security, data integrity and uniform administration Procedures.
11
Cont.... The DBMS is perhaps most useful for providing a centralized view of data that can be accessed by multiple users, from multiple locations, in a controlled manner. E.g (Exam Result) A DBMS can limit what data the end user sees, as well as how that end user can view the data, providing many views of a single database schema. End users and software programs are free from having to understand where the data is physically located or on what type of storage media it resides because the DBMS handles all requests.

Hierarchical Model Data is Organized into a simple tree like structure
It was the first DBMS Model (1960's) Data is Stored Hierarchically either in top down or bottom up Data is represented using parent child relationship Each parent can have many children but children have only one parent. All attributes of specific records are listed under entity types Entity type is nothing but a table Each individual record is represented as a row Each individual attributes is represented as a columns

Network Model Like hierarchical model this uses pointers towards data
Allows each record to have multiple parent child records Not Necessarily a downwards tree structure Entities are organized in a graph in which some entities can be accessed through several paths.

Object Oriented Model Data Stored in the form of objects, the structure which are called “Classes” that display data within it. Defines database as a collection of objects that contains both data members values and operations that are allowed on the data. Inter-relationship and constraints are implemented through objects and links. Evolved to handle more complex applications such as database for scientific experiments, geographic information system, CAD (computer Aided Design). The DBMS developed using this mode is called OODBMS. Object model deal with data as higher level (with object surrounding data). Combine the capabilities of object oriented programming language ( Example: C++, Java)
